Parents​ may notice a few minor side effects in their 1-3 year olds⁣ after consuming Nido Milk. These side effects are⁢ typically mild and temporary. Common minor side effects may ⁢include:

  • Diarrhea: Some children may ​experience​ loose stools ‌after drinking‍ Nido‌ Milk. This can⁣ be caused by ​lactose ⁢intolerance or an upset stomach.
  • Bloating: Gas‌ and bloating⁣ are​ possible side effects of Nido‍ Milk consumption in young children.⁣ This ‍may be due to difficulty ​digesting the milk proteins.

It ​is important to monitor ⁣your child’s ⁢reactions to Nido Milk ‍and⁣ consult a healthcare ‍provider if these‌ side effects persist or worsen. Remember to ​introduce new ⁤foods ⁢slowly and ⁣in small amounts to ⁤help your child’s ⁢digestive system adjust.

– Major ⁣side effects of Nido Milk for 1-3 years ⁣old

It is important to be aware of the potential major⁤ side effects that Nido‍ Milk may have on⁤ children aged 1-3 years‌ old.​ While Nido Milk is generally ‌safe for consumption,⁤ some children may ⁣experience adverse ⁣reactions to the milk. ‌Here are ⁢some major side ​effects to ⁤watch ⁣out for:

**- ‌Allergic Reactions:** ​Some children may ​be allergic to specific ⁢ingredients found in‍ Nido ⁤Milk, such as ⁢cow’s milk protein. Symptoms​ of an allergic reaction ⁣may include hives,⁣ vomiting, diarrhea,⁢ and⁣ difficulty breathing. It is ⁢important ​to consult a pediatrician if​ your child exhibits any⁤ signs of an allergic⁣ reaction after consuming‍ Nido Milk.⁣ **- Digestive Issues:** Nido Milk may cause‌ digestive⁤ issues in some children, such as bloating, ‌gas, or constipation. If your child experiences persistent⁣ digestive problems ‍after consuming Nido Milk,⁣ it is ‌advisable⁣ to seek⁢ medical advice to determine the underlying cause and find alternative⁢ dietary options.

Q: What are ​the​ common side effects ⁤of Nido​ Milk ⁢for children​ aged 1-3 years​ old?
A: Some common side‌ effects ​of Nido ‌Milk for children in‍ this age group include⁤ constipation,⁣ bloating, and gas.

Q: Are there ‌any ⁤serious side effects ‌that parents should be ‌aware of?
A: While rare, ⁣some children ⁢may have an allergic reaction to certain ingredients in‍ Nido Milk, which can manifest as hives, ​swelling, or difficulty breathing. It is important ​to ⁢consult ⁤a doctor if any ⁤serious side effects occur.

Q: Can Nido Milk cause any long-term health issues ⁤ for⁣ young children?
A:​ There is limited research ⁣on the long-term effects‍ of Nido Milk specifically on children‌ aged 1-3 years ⁣old. However, excessive intake of certain vitamins and minerals in⁢ fortified milk products may lead to potential health issues ⁣over time.
